Cain Park Arts Festival Plans In-Person Return In 2021
The beloved local arts fest is planning to bring art and culture to a starved city, organizers said.

CLEVELAND HEIGHTS, OH — The Cain Park Arts Festival plans to return in July with an in-person event.
The beloved local festival is scheduled for July 9-11, but is subject to any pandemic restrictions. Organizers are now accepting applications for artists looking to exhibit their work during the event.
Arts Festival Director George Kozmon said the plan is to streamline the event in 2021 to ensure attendee safety.

"Beyond the normal logistics of holding the festival, we are focused on safe interaction between our exhibiting artists and the audience," he told Patch in an email. Applications for interested artists will be accepted until March 5.
Attendees will be able to to participate in the 150 foot long public mural project, which was launched three years ago. There are also plans for the Feinberg Art Gallery to showcase fine artwork, to work with students from the Cleveland Institute of Art and to feature a variety of food and music.

Kozmon said details are still being hammered out but further announcements are expected.
